Photos: Bobi Wine’s brother Chairman Nyanzi shows off new mansion

The Ssentamu family is slowly but surely becoming well-known for their ownership of extravagant mansions. First, it was Bobi Wine, also known as Kyagulanyi Ssentamu, followed by Banjo Man, Eddy Yawe, Mikie Wine, and Dax Vibez.

Now, their elder brother, Chairman Nyanzi Ssentamu, is also currently enjoying the best of his life. Just a few days after graduating with a Master’s Degree in Peace and Conflict Studies from Makerere University, he has shown off his luxurious mansion.

This mansion, which sits on over an acre, is located in Kira Municipality.

Nyanzi unveiled it during his graduation celebration over the weekend. The house boasts over seven bedrooms, a swimming pool, and a spacious parking lot.
